IMPORTANT INSTRUCTIONS
When you log in on that week you will have a new button under the photo that allows you to select Guest Editor awards for pictures.
Please look at all photos uploaded to the gallery in your allocated week and only select the photos you think are outstanding - it's quality over quantity please. You can still vote as normal on pictures you like while reserving your awards for those you think are special
Also please do not just select pictures from your favourite genres or ones uploaded by your connections or friends. We are looking for an unbiased selection. If you don't feel you can meet any of this criteria please stand down.
The button becomes active at 0:00 on Monday and runs right through the week and stays active on the following Monday so you can catch up with Sunday's uploads

The Guest Editor award as it has new eyes and a new perspective each week is a valuable resource. No matter how one person tries they instinctively will choose certain images either that they subconsciously "like" or that follows the latest photographic "trend". This inevitably leads to a group of people being more popular because their images will "click" and this creates the undercurrent of perception that exists that certain people are favoured. The guest editor award even if its only 17 people doing three stints a year will always bring some freshness. It also means that a wider selection of people get awards which to many is good because they feel its an achievement however small in the run of things.
It could easily be argued that they is no need for both Editors Choice and Highly Commended as they are both the choice of one individual, why not just have Editors Selection of the Finest of each days images and put them on equal listing staus with Guest Editor as far as visibility is concerned? This would also raise the status of the Guest Editor and hopefully attract more people to volunteer.
The bottom line is still the wider selection of people who get awards from whatever source (assuming of course they are quality images) will in the long term generate more interest in Ephotozine and hence the benefits to all.
